Tirwa,
Tirwa is a small town located in the Kannauj district of Uttar Pradesh, India. It is known for its rich history dating back to ancient times. The town is famous for its traditional craft of perfume making using natural floral extracts.
Tirwa is also home to several temples and historical sites that attract tourists seeking a glimpse of its cultural heritage.

Bedmi Poori with Aloo Sabzi
Bedmi Poori is a deep-fried bread made from wheat flour dough with a filling of spiced urad dal. It is often served with a flavorful potato curry. Visitors can savor this dish at local street food stalls in Tirwa.
Balushahi
A traditional dessert made from deep-fried dough, soaked in sugar syrup, and garnished with pistachios. It can be found at sweet shops in Tirwa, such as the famous Lal Sweets.
